Ingredients

– 4 halibut fillets
– 1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
– 2 cloves of garlic, minced
– 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
– 1 teaspoon lemon zest
– 1 teaspoon dried oregano
– 1 teaspoon dried thyme
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Directions

1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and lightly grease a baking dish with olive oil.
2. Place the halibut fillets in the prepared baking dish and season them with salt and pepper.
3. In a small bowl, mix the olive oil, minced garlic, lemon juice, lemon zest, oregano, and thyme.
4. Drizzle this herb mixture over the halibut fillets, making sure to coat them evenly.
5. Cover the baking dish with foil and bake in the preheated oven for about 15-20 minutes, or until the halibut is cooked through and flakes easily with a fork.
6. Once done, remove the foil and broil for an additional 2-3 minutes to lightly brown the top.
7. Garnish with fresh chopped parsley before serving.
8. Serve the Greek Style Baked Halibut with Herbs hot, alongside some roasted vegetables or a Greek salad for a complete Mediterranean meal experience.

What is Greek Style Baked Halibut with Herbs?

Greek Style Baked Halibut with Herbs is a delicious dish where fresh halibut fillets are marinated in a mixture of ol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, and a blend of Mediterranean herbs such as oregano, thyme, and parsley. The fish is then baked to perfection, resulting in a flavorful and tender meal with a Greek twist.

How do you make Greek Style Baked Halibut with Herbs?

To make Greek Style Baked Halibut with Herbs, start by marinating halibut fillets in a mixture of ol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, oregano, thyme, parsley, salt, and pepper. Let the fish marinate for about 30 minutes in the refrigerator. Then, bake the halibut in the oven until it is cooked through and flakes easily with a fork. Serve the baked halibut with a garnish of fresh herbs and lemon wedges for a touch of brightness.
